JOHN S. BUSKY, OF BROOKLYN, NEW YORK.
DESIGN FOR A SHOE-SHANK.
SPECIFICATION forming part of Design No. 35,709,'da.ted February 11, I902.
Application filed December 28, 1901- Serial No. 87,625- Term of patent '7 years.
To all whom it may concern:
Be it known that 1, JOHN S. BUSKY, aciti zen of the United States, and a resident of the city of New York, borough of Brooklyn, in the county of Kings and State ofNew York, have invented and produced a new and original Design fora Shoe-Shank, of which the following is a full, clear, and exact description.
Reference is to be had to the accompanying drawings, forming a part of this specification, in Which- Figure l is a plan view of a shoe-shank, showing my design. Fig. 2 is an edge view thereof, and Fig. 3 is an end view.
The leading feature of my design for a shoeshank consists in providing it with transversely-disposed ribs or corrugations.
Referring particularly to the drawings, the
shank has inwardly-curved side edges and ends, and it is transversely arched and pro- 20 vided with a central longitudinal rib, from which ribs or corrugations extend outward to the side edges and at a slight angle.
